The W371A is specifically engineered to pair with the 8341, 8351, and 8361 models from Genelec’s 'The Ones' series. When combined, these create a full-range, high-performance monitoring system.
By using dual woofers—one forward-facing and one rear-facing—the system manages how sound radiates into your room. It uses Genelec’s GLM software to minimize detrimental reflections and smooth out the frequency response in the lowest four octaves.
Yes, the GLM software is essential for the W371A. It handles the signal processing required to optimize the subwoofer's output based on your specific room acoustics and the operating mode you choose.
The three modes allow you to prioritize a flat, neutral frequency response, maintain the directivity characteristics of your main monitors, or actively reduce room reflections. You can select the mode that best suits your specific monitoring environment and listening preferences.
As a free-standing system, the W371A offers significant flexibility in placement. However, because it is designed to work in tandem with your monitors to control directivity, you should use the GLM software to calibrate the system once you have settled on a position.
Each unit measures 15.8 inches wide by 15.8 inches deep and stands 43.5 inches tall. Given that it weighs 135 pounds, ensure your floor or stand can support the weight and that you have sufficient clearance for the cabinet.
